    • What I recommend for someone just starting out: Medic Selbstlader 1916, get this ASAP M1911 or 1903 Hammerless Bandage Pouch - heals in large chunks, heals on the move, can be tossed to teammates a fair distance Medical Syringe - Revives downed teammates, can kill enemies if you "charge it up" before you stab them or Rifle Grenade-HE - high explosive, bounces like a frag so you can use it around corners Frag/Stick Grenade or Incendiary Grenade - large radius, high damage, incendiary does damage over time, however Shovel I think the only things you'd need to buy with War Bonds are the 1916, 1903, Rifle Grenade, and/or the Incendiary. It's basically all starting equipment, which is actually the most useful, IMO. 1. Don't run around like a blind chicken. Always have a plan, if you leave cover know where to find more cover, and try to get there quick. 2. Listen. If you hear footsteps or a tank and you don't see anything on your minimap, it's an enemy. 3. Don't run over and try to heal/revive everyone. Take your time and make sure the area is clear first. No point in running over to a dead teammate just to give the enemy a 2nd kill. 4. Spot like your life depends on it. SPOT EVERYTHING. It's not only helpful for your own aim, if you see a red indicator above an enemy, but it's helpful for your team.

          • - Don't Leroy Jenkins the shit out of combat, Battlefield is weighted more toward team play instead of solo. - Play the objective in order to rank up your classes, which in turn grant you access to new guns. - Be sure to have at least one anti-armor guy (Assault or Support w/ limpet charges) in your squad if you're in a game with vehicles.

                    • Get all classes to rank 3 but rank assault and recon to 10 for the henry (sniper) and hellriegal (assault). Every class is useful. If you're going to be medic don't be a social reject and not revive people >20m away. Same goes for support class, resupply people, you can just run by people pressing the button to throw the ammo patch down and it'll magnetize to them from up to 15m away. Flanks are everywhere. You have to constantly be on the move to be successful. Coming from someone who gets 40+ kills nearly every match. Conquest of course.
